基本要素专题

spring揭秘07-aop01-aop基本要素及代理模式3种实现

文章目录 【README】【1】AOP思想演进【1.1】AOL:面向切面语言【1.2】AOP实现设想【1.3】java平台的AOP实现机制【1.3.1】动态代理(需要目标类实现接口)【1.3.2】动态字节码增强(不需要目标类实现接口)【1.3.3】自定义加载器 【2】AOP基本要素【2.1】Joinpoint切点【2.2】Pointcut切点表达式【2.3】Advice通知(横切逻辑)【2

面向对象的3个基本要素5个基本设计原则

面向对象的3个基本要素:封装、继承、多态 面向对象的5个基本设计原则: 单一职责原则(Single-Resposibility Principle)     其核心思想为:一个类,最好只做一件事,只有一个引起它的变化。单一职责原则可以看做是低耦合、高内聚在面向对象原则上的引申,将职责定义为引起变化的原因,以提高内聚性来减少引起变化的原因。职责过多,可能引起它变化的原因就越多,这将导致

spring揭秘09-aop基本要素抽象与通知及切面织入

文章目录 【README】【1】spring aop中的Joinpoint切点【2】spring aop中的Pointcut描述切点的表达式【2.1】ClassFilter:根据class类型匹配【2.2】MethodMatcher:根据方法匹配【2.2.1】StaticMethodMatcher 静态方法匹配器【2.2.2】DynamicMethodMatcher 动态方法匹配器 【2.3

spring揭秘07-aop基本要素及代理模式3种实现

文章目录 【README】【1】AOP思想演进【1.1】AOL:面向切面语言【1.2】AOP实现设想【1.3】java平台的AOP实现机制【1.3.1】动态代理(需要目标类实现接口)【1.3.2】动态字节码增强(不需要目标类实现接口)【1.3.3】自定义加载器 【2】AOP基本要素【2.1】Joinpoint切点【2.2】Pointcut切点表达式【2.3】Advice通知(横切逻辑)【2

protocol buffers 基本要素:基于c++

为什么使用protocol buffers?      我们将使用一个非常简单的例子,做一个地址簿的应用。在这个地址簿中,我们可以读写联系人的信息,有名字,ID,还有电话号码。      那么我们如何序列化和反序列化一个这样的数据结构呢?下面列举了几种方式:      首先说的方法就是直接传递结构体的二进制序列,但是这是一种不好的方法,因为发送端和接受端都要相同的存储配置,字节序等。同时,由

做一个Leader的基本要素

作为一个想成为Leader的程序猿,在工作日常中总结一些作为一个Leader应该具备的要素,以警戒今后成为Leader的我! 分派任务时,要有一定的威严性,最忌用商量的口吻给程序猿们分派任务。最忌朝令夕改,确定并经过评审的设计最好不要改动,稍作修改,改掉的不仅仅是程序猿们辛辛苦苦码出来作品,还有可能是程序猿们的积极性和耐心。而且频繁的这种改动会对程序猿的思路产生很大的干扰。一定不要吝啬自己对程序

信息系统项目管理师0086:项目内外部运行环境(6项目管理概论—6.2项目基本要素—6.2.5项目内外部运行环境)

点击查看专栏目录 文章目录 6.2.5项目内外部运行环境1.组织过程资产2.组织内部的事业环境因素3.组织外部的事业环境因素 6.2.5项目内外部运行环境   项目在内部和外部环境中存在和运作,这些环境对价值交付有不同程度的影响。内部和外部环境可能会影响规划和其他项目活动。这些影响可能会对项目特征、干系人或项目团队产生有利、不利或中性的影响。 1.组织过程资产 过

信息系统项目管理师0087:组织系统(6项目管理概论—6.2项目基本要素—6.2.6组织系统)

点击查看专栏目录 文章目录 6.2.6组织系统1.治理框架2.管理要素3.组织结构类型 6.2.6组织系统   项目运行时会受到项目所在的组织结构和治理框架的影响与制约。为有效且高效地开展项目,项目经理需要了解组织内的组织机构及职责分配情况,帮助自己有效地利用其权力、影响力、能力、领导力等,以便成功完成项目。   组织内多种因素的交互影响创造出一个独特的组织系统,该组织

信息系统项目管理师0084:项目成功的标准(6项目管理概论—6.2项目基本要素—6.2.3项目成功的标准)

点击查看专栏目录 文章目录 6.2.3项目成功的标准 6.2.3项目成功的标准   确定项目是否成功是项目管理中最常见的挑战之一。   时间、成本、范围和质量等项目管理测量指标,历来被视为确定项目是否成功的最重要的因素。确定项目是否成功还应考虑项目目标的实现情况。   明确记录项目目标并选择可测量的目标是项目成功的关键。主要干系人和项目经理应思考三个问题:①怎样才算项目

测试用例8个基本要素

写出一个测试用例包含的8个基本要素 用例编号 用例标题 所属项目 用例级别 预置条件 测试数据 执行步骤 预期结果

绩效管理过程:有效绩效管理所必需的基本要素?

建立有效的绩效管理框架涉及一些基本要素,包括: 目标设定- 您需要以正确的方式设定目标,他们需要有意义和被理解。员工应了解这些个人目标为何重要以及他们如何促进组织目标。员工将更加关心自己的角色,并在知道(并真正理解)工作重要性时更加投入。 目标设定应该是一个协作过程。一旦目标从组织中的高层组织向下倾斜,现代公司就在向上调整目标。因此,目标设定应包括与员工会面,并在公司目标,方向和障碍方面保

事务的基本要素(ACID)

数据库事务(Transanction)正确执行的四个基本要素: 1、原子性(Atomicity):事务开始后所有操作,要么全部完成,要么全部不完成,不可能停滞在中间环节。事务执行过程中出错,会回滚(Rollback)到事务开始前的状态,所有的操作就像没有发生一样。也就是说事务是一个不可分割的整体,就像化学中学过的原子,是物质构成的基本单位 2、一致性(Consistency):事务开始前和结束后,

Verilog HDL程序设计——基本要素

Verilog基本上熟悉了,继续整理一下Verilog的学习笔记吧。前面记载了Verilog的结构,写Verilog的结构有了,但是该怎么写呢?在写之前就得了解一下Verilog的一些基本要素了,也就是Verilog是怎么一点一点写出来的。   一、标识符与注释 前面已经说到,模块名的定义要符合标识符的定义,那么什么是标识符呢?它的语法是什么呢?   ①标识符是赋给对象的唯一名称,

架构的基本要素

1.架构设计如何规划? 架构设计目标 Do the right thing right 做对的事情 把对的事情做正确 架构设计方法 架构立方体:应用技术 功能运行 逻辑物理 架构设计输出 可落地的架构和系统 2.架构设计模式 分而治之 迭代式设计 3.架构设计输入 需要解决的目标 功能性需求 实现的自由度 限制 做到什么程度 质量 现有的手段 资产和技术 功能需求:使用WH分析法who whic

使文案更有说服力的 10 个基本要素

爱发猫认为通过了解一些基本规则,可以轻松提高您所写句子的响应率。 推销信、博客、电子邮件通讯都是一样的,很多情况下,只要注意细节,一份文案的回复率就可以达到5倍或10倍。 所有这些都只是一些提示,但如果你遵循这些并写一份副本,你会更有说服力。当然,这些不仅对销售业绩有用,而且对写任何句子都有用,所以让我们再次回顾一下。 1. 从读者的角度写  除非您有特定原因,否则文案应以现在时态书写

销售文案的10个基本要素

文案对于在网络营销中取得成果至关重要。 无论您对产品或服务有多自信,如果没有文案技巧,您将无法获得结果。 然而,在现实中,令人惊讶的是,有许多企业主并没有试图通过追求产品的质量来改善本质文案,作为产品或服务的销售业绩没有增加的原因。 这非常重要,因此,如果您的产品或服务销售不佳,请先查看您的销售信函的文案。 供您参考,以下是撰写销售文案的 10 个基本要素。 顶部副本 正文副本

VTK 三维场景的基本要素(相机) vtkCamera 相机的运动

相机的运动 当物体在处于静止位置时,相机可以在物体周围移动,摄取不同角度的图像    移动   移动分为相机的移动,和相机焦点的移动;移动改变了相机相对焦点的位置,离焦点更近或者更远;这样就会改变被渲染的物体在视野中的部分;   相机的移动可以有水平上的移动,垂直方向的移动,前后的移动; vtkCamera::Dolly(double value);将相机与焦点的距离除以给定的推

VTK 三维场景的基本要素(相机) vtkCamera

观众的眼睛好比三维渲染场景中的相机,在VTK中用vtkCamera类来表示。vtkCamera负责把三维场景投影到二维平面,如屏幕,相机投影示意图如下图所示。 1.与相机投影相关的要素主要有如下几个: 1)相机位置: 相机所处的位置,用vtkCamera::SetPosition()方法设置。 2)相机焦点: 用vtkCamera::SetFocusPoint()方法设置,默认的焦点位置

vtk三维场景基本要素 灯光、相机、颜色、纹理映射 简介

整理一下VTK  三维场景基本要素,后面会一一进行整理; 1. 灯光 vtkLight 剧场里有各式各样的灯光,三维渲染场景中也一样,可以有多个灯光存在。灯光和相机 是三维渲染场景必备的要素,vtkRenderer会自动创建默认的灯光和相机;   vtkLight可以分为位置灯光(Positional Light,也叫聚光灯)和方向灯光(Direction Light)。 位置灯光是光源位置在

用javascript打造一个简单的小人互殴系统(实现javascript游戏基本要素:生命值、伤害、移动、闪避等)

这个东西,还是和上次那个太阳系模型一样,是我在在职MBA课堂上无聊时随便做的,图片是随便弄的,因为是闹着玩的,所以并没有使用html5或者svg。 简单说,这个东西给人物加了碰撞检测和血条、伤害计算等等一些游戏里面最基本的元素,每个小人会随机选择场上的另一个小人为目标向它发射攻击的球球,球球如果命中敌方,敌方就会受到伤害,血量为零就挂了。每个小人都会在画面里面随机移动,至少不能傻站着挨打吧。

云计算:现代技术的基本要素

在儿童教育的早期阶段,幼儿园传授塑造未来行为的基本原则。 今天,您可以以类似的方式思考云计算:它已成为现代技术架构中的基本元素。云现在在数字交互、安全和基础设施开发中发挥着关键作用。 云不仅仅是另一种工具,它还是一个基石,为支持当今数字生态系统的复杂网络提供必要的支持。 就像幼儿园课程为认知发展奠定了基础一样,云提供了对于构建和操作复杂数字系统至关重要的基本功能。基于云的安全领域的最新进

云计算:现代技术的基本要素

众所周知,在儿童教育的早期阶段,幼儿园都会传授塑造未来行为的一些基本准则。 今天,我们可以以类似的方式思考云计算:它已成为现代技术架构中的基本元素。云现在在数字交互、安全和基础设施开发中发挥着关键作用。云不仅仅是另一种工具,它还是一个基石,为支持当今数字生态系统的复杂网络提供必要的支持。 就像幼儿园课程为认知发展奠定了基础一样,云提供了对于构建和操作复杂数字系统至关重要的基本功能。基于云的安全

高并发 分布式 架构 的 几大 基本要素

高并发 分布式 架构 的 几大 基本要素 服务治理 RPC 消息 缓存 日志 参考这篇文章:      包银消费CTO汤向军:消费金融大数据风控架构与实践     转载于:https://www.cnblogs.com/KSongKing/p/9133558.html

社群运营方案的基本要素有哪些?

在日常工作中,我们经常需要写各种各样的方案,比如活动方案、策划方案等等,社群运营也不例外。一个好的社群运营方案,需要我们在前期做大量的调研和准备工作,然后在方案确定之后,强有力的落地执行,通过不断的优化、改进、复盘,才能达到预期目标,那么,社群运营方案的基本要素都有哪些呢?我们根据社群运营的实际情况,进行了总结,一共有以下六点。 一、搭建社群的目的 为什么要做社群?大多数公司和个人做社群运营,都是

【软考】信息安全基本要素

目录 一、机密性二、完整性三、可用性四、可控性五、可审查性六、可鉴别性七、不可抵赖性八、可靠性 一、机密性 1.保证信息不泄露给未经授权的进程或实体,只供授权者使用 二、完整性 1.信息只能被得到允许的人修改,并且能够被判别该信息是否已被篡改过 2.一个系统也应该按其原来规定的功能运行,不被非授权者操纵 三、可用性 1.只有授权者才可以在需要时访问该数据,而非

技术周刊 · 天工人巧日争新 | 把 Node.js 搬进浏览器;GitHub 团队的跨框架组件;系统架构整洁的基本要素;改写规则的 Shell 脚本工具;思考产品“靠谱程度”

蒲公英 · JELLY技术期刊 Vol.40 时代总是滚滚洪流不断向前,总有新的事物和各种有趣的东西不断出现在我们的眼前。所谓“删繁就简三秋树,领异标新二月花”,简化开发流程,优化技术方案,通过量变带来质变,带来新的需求与思考。 就好像我们在开发的过程中去追求构架的整洁之道,就可以帮助我们更高效的去管理代码和项目中的各个模块。同样的,不论是通用的组件库,还是简单易用的脚本工具、Cloud